Output 56e32dc2c7c93321ce99f4fc49cc7517936de469338fcdc10b9eb662a326f751:2

value
340000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e098a40e2e87e2b4e9bef844009406e9a6144516 OP_EQUAL
address
3NAa9BhoDapGtsgUo5SdoVNLgELB5t61mG
transaction
56e32dc2c7c93321ce99f4fc49cc7517936de469338fcdc10b9eb662a326f751
spent
true